About the Role:


We are looking for an enthusiastic, innovative, and self-driven AI Adoption Intern to join our Digital Transformation team.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who is passionate about Artificial Intelligence and eager to help transform how people work. You will work closely with teams across the Group to identify opportunities where AI can improve productivity, simplify processes, automate repetitive tasks, and enhance decision-making.


Key Responsibilities:



  • Promote AI adoption across business functions.

  • Research and evaluate emerging AI technologies and business applications.

  • Identify manual and repetitive processes that can be improved through AI.

  • Develop practical AI use cases for Finance, Procurement, HR, Sales, Operations, Engineering, Manufacturing, and other departments.

  • Conduct AI awareness sessions and user training workshops.

  • Create user guides, prompt libraries, and AI best practice documentation.

  • Assist with AI-powered workflow automation initiatives.

  • Monitor AI adoption and prepare progress reports for management.

  • Support the development of responsible AI usage guidelines and governance practices.

  • Stay up to date with the latest developments in Artificial Intelligence and recommend relevant innovations.


Qualifications and Experience:



  • A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, Information Systems, Business Information Technology, Data Science, Artificial Intelligence, or a related field.

  • A First Class Honours or Second Class Upper (Upper Division) degree.

  • Demonstrated interest in Artificial Intelligence and emerging technologies.

  • Excellent analytical, communication, and problem-solving skills.

  • Strong written and verbal English communication skills.
